Golden doodles are a delightful mix of Golden Retrievers and Poodles, combining the best traits of both breeds. Known for their friendly, social nature, these dogs are often hypoallergenic due to their Poodle lineage. They’re smart, eager to please, and make excellent companions for families, singles, and seniors alike. With their playful demeanor and love for bonding, Goldendoodles have become a popular choice for dog lovers everywhere!

The Best Diet for a Golden Doodle’s Health
Golden Doodles thrive on a balanced diet that includes high-quality protein and healthy fats. Fresh veggies like carrots and peas can add nutrients and excitement to their meals. Always check with your vet for personalized feeding guidelines to keep your pup happy and healthy!
Grooming Tips for a Healthy Golden Doodle Coat
Grooming your Golden Doodle is key to keeping that fluffy coat healthy and shiny. Regular brushing helps prevent mats and tangles, so make it a routine to brush a few times a week. Don’t forget to schedule professional grooming every couple of months for a fresh look!

Common Health Issues in Golden Doodles
Golden Doodles are generally healthy, but they can face a few common health issues. Hip dysplasia and allergies are among the top concerns for this breed. Regular vet check-ups can help catch any problems early and keep your pup happy.
Golden Doodle Breed History and Origins
The Golden Doodle is a charming mix of the Golden Retriever and the Poodle. This friendly breed was developed to combine the best traits of both parent breeds, making them intelligent and sociable. Over the years, they’ve become popular family pets known for their playful nature and low-shedding coats.

Understanding Golden Doodle Lifespan and Aging
Golden Doodles typically live around 10 to 15 years, depending on factors like size and health care. Staying active and maintaining a good diet can help them age gracefully. As they grow older, regular vet visits become even more important to ensure they stay happy and healthy.
